How to tell how many holes in a golf cart battery?

You will be able to see 3, 4, or 6 holes. By multiplying these holes by two, you will determine the battery’s voltage. Multiply this number by the total number of batteries installed in your golf cart. A Guide To Golf Cart Batteries: How Much Do Batteries Cost?

How much do golf cart batteries cost?

Some packs cost as much as $2500 when you start dealing with 72 Volt systems and sealed for lithium batteries. But, for the typical lead acid battery pack, $900 to $1500 is about the norm. This price range is assuming you are working with a local golf cart dealer.

What are the terminals on a lithium-ion battery?

Modern Li-Ion batteries are constructed of a graphite negative terminal, cobalt, manganese or iron phosphate positive terminal and an electrolyte that transports the lithium ions. The electrolyte may be a gel, a polymer (Li-Ion/Polymer batteries) or a hybrid of a gel and a polymer.

Which label should be on a container of lithium batteries?

If you're shipping lithium metal batteries as a standalone (no other items in the package), use a battery label with UN3090. If you're shipping lithium metal batteries contained in or packed with equipment, use a battery label with UN3091.

How do I find the UN number for my battery?

The appropriate UN number preceded by the letters “UN” and it should be at least 12mm high - “UN3090” for lithium metal cells or batteries; - “UN3480” for lithium ion cells or batteries; - “UN3091” for lithium metal cells or batteries contained in, or packed with, equipment; or - “UN3481” for lithium ion cells or ...

What does the lithium battery sticker look like?

The border of the mark must have red diagonal hatchings with a minimum width of 5mm. The symbol (group of batteries, one damaged and emitting flame, above the UN number for lithium ion or lithium metal batteries or cells) must be black on white or suitable contrasting background.

Do lithium battery labels have to be in color?

The new symbol on the mark must be black on white (or suitable contrasting background) and consists of a group of batteries, one damaged and emitting flame above the UN number for lithium ion or lithium metal batteries or cells. The old “lithium battery handling label” can no longer be used.

How do you wire a 48V golf cart battery?

The main positive lead for the battery bank coming from the frame of the cart will connect to the positive terminal of the first battery in the bank. Then, connect a cable from the negative terminal of the first battery to the positive terminal of the subsequent battery in the bank.

How many lithium batteries do I need for a 48V golf cart?

If you're using a 48V lithium battery connected in parallel you don't need to install a specific number of batteries to meet the voltage requirements – you install the number of batteries that will give you the mileage range you desire. You can use as few as 2 batteries or up to 6 batteries in a typical golf car.

How to tell 12 volt golf cart battery?

A 12 volt battery can be identified by seeing batteries with 6 cell caps on top of the battery indicating 2 volts per cell. A single 12 volt golf cart battery will have the least amperage capacity and is commonly used in 72 volt battery systems which are not terribly common among golf carts. EZGO golf cart batteries are known to be use 4-12 volt battery systems in some of their golf cart models.

How to tell if a golf cart battery is 6 volts?

A 6 volt golf cart battery can be identified by seeing batteries with 3 cell caps on top of the battery indicating 2 volts per cell. Generally speaking, a single 6 volt battery will have the highest amperage capacity and will allow for the greatest range in an 8-6 volt battery system.

How does amperage affect golf carts?

It will determine how far you can travel on a single charge in an electric golf cart. The more amperage in a battery pack, the further you can drive before having to charge.

How many cycles does a lithium battery last?

Also, some lithium batteries carry a lifetime warranty and can deliver up to 5000 cycles versus the typical 100-500 cycles for a lead acid battery. Even with a 500-cycle lead acid battery cart, that means replacing the power source 10 times more than the lithium-ion model.

How much does a lithium battery weigh?

A lead acid battery can weigh as much as 130 pounds and averages around 65 pounds. A lithium-ion battery averages 28 pounds. Less weight means your cart will be able to haul more weight at a greater speed. And, they are capable of holding a single full charge for a year instead of losing a charge slowly over time.

How many cycles does a golf cart battery last?

Unlike the traditional lead-acid golf cart batteries, which have an average of 500 charge cycles, a lithium-ion battery has the ability to reach a peak of 5,000 charge cycles. Traditional golf cart batteries require numerous amounts of maintenance for enhancing their shelf life.
